ENHYPEN, 2.14 million copies in first week…”2nd highest among K-pop albums this year”

Image 1

ENHYPEN has achieved double million-seller status with just its initial sales figures. This is the second highest record among K-pop groups this year.

Hanteo Chart announced on the 12th, "ENHYPEN sold a total of 2,145,499 copies of their mini album 'D ESIRE: UNLEASH' in the first week since its release."

ENHYPEN reached double million-seller status within the initial sales period. This year, only ENHYPEN and SEVENTEEN have recorded such a feat among K-pop artists.

With their new release, ENHYPEN also broke their own record for first-day album sales, selling over 1.89 million copies on the release date, the 5th of this month.

They also achieved a career high in Japan, topping Oricon's 'Weekly Combined Album Ranking,' 'Weekly Album Ranking,' and 'Weekly Digital Album Ranking,' as well as Billboard Japan's 'Top Album Sales' chart.

Their music is gaining global popularity as well. The title track 'Bad Desire' has entered the Spotify 'Daily Top Song Global' chart at number 72 and is still charting.

The response has been even hotter in South Korea and Japan. They reached the top of Bugs' 'Real-time Chart' in South Korea and AWA's ‘Real-time Rising Music Top 100’ chart in Japan.
